How to Size Your Off-Grid Kit for Kotdwar's Load Profile
Sizing an off-grid solar kit for a location like Kotdwar involves a methodical approach to match system components to energy demand. The process begins with a detailed load assessment:
- Peak Load: Sum of all appliances that might operate simultaneously. This determines the required inverter capacity.
- Daily Energy Throughput: Total Watt-hours (Wh) or Kilowatt-hours (kWh) consumed over a 24-hour period. This drives battery capacity and solar array size.
- Autonomy: Number of days the system must operate solely on stored energy without solar input. For Kotdwar, planning for 2-3 days of autonomy is often prudent given potential winter fog or extended monsoon cloud cover.
Rule-of-thumb sizing suggests that for every 1 kWh of daily consumption, approximately 1-1.5 kWp of solar panels and 3-5 kWh of battery storage are needed, adjusted for local irradiance and desired autonomy.
What to Look for in Panels, Inverter, Battery, and Balance-of-System
An effective Off-Grid Solar Kit India is a sum of its well-matched parts. When evaluating components, consider:
- Solar Panels: High-efficiency modules with good low-light performance are crucial, especially in regions that experience varied weather. Durability against environmental stressors like hailstorms and strong winds is also important for Kotdwar.
- Inverter: A pure sine wave inverter with high surge handling capability is essential for motor loads (pumps, ACs) and sensitive electronics. Its efficiency directly impacts system performance.
- Battery: The energy storage unit must offer a high cycle life, good depth of discharge, and stable performance across the Cold/Composite temperature range.
- Balance-of-System (BOS): This includes mounting structures, cabling, junction boxes, and safety devices. All BOS components must be robust, weather-resistant, and correctly rated for the system's power and voltage.
Integration of these components is key for optimal performance and longevity.

How do I estimate peak load and daily energy for an off-grid setup in Kotdwar?
To estimate peak load, list all electrical appliances and their power ratings (Watts). Sum the ratings of all appliances that might run simultaneously. For daily energy, multiply each appliance's power rating by its daily operating hours and sum these values. This gives you total Watt-hours per day. What integration considerations matter when combining panels, inverter and battery?
When combining components, ensure voltage and current compatibility between panels and the inverter's MPPT input. The inverter's power rating must exceed the peak load, and its charging capabilities must match the battery's requirements. Battery capacity must align with daily energy demand and desired autonomy.
